Hormones, these molecular messengers, orchestrate everything from mood and metabolism to muscle repair and cognitive function. When their levels drift outside optimal ranges, a cascade of sub-optimal effects ensues, impacting energy, body composition, and mental acuity.
Consider testosterone, a prime example of a hormone vital for both male and female vitality. In men, it governs muscle mass, bone density, libido, and even cognitive drive. Levels naturally decline with age, contributing to feelings of fatigue, reduced strength, and an overall loss of vigor.
Recalibrating these levels through Testosterone Replacement Therapy (TRT) provides a strategic intervention. This process involves the introduction of exogenous testosterone to restore physiological concentrations, thereby reactivating the body’s capacity for robust anabolism and mental clarity. Peptide therapies represent another sophisticated layer in biological recalibration. Peptides are short chains of amino acids that act as signaling molecules within the body. Unlike full proteins, their smaller structure allows for targeted interactions with specific receptors, initiating precise biological responses.
For instance, growth hormone-releasing peptides (GHRPs) like Sermorelin or Ipamorelin stimulate the body’s natural production and release of growth hormone. This stimulation can yield improvements in body composition, enhanced cellular repair, improved sleep quality, and accelerated recovery from physical exertion. These peptides do not introduce synthetic hormones; rather, they provide precise instructions, activating the body’s innate regenerative capabilities. A typical strategic internal calibration process often unfolds in distinct phases ∞
- Initial Diagnostic Blueprinting ∞ Comprehensive blood work establishes baseline hormone levels, including total and free testosterone, estrogen, thyroid hormones, and key metabolic markers such as glucose and insulin sensitivity. This phase also evaluates nutrient deficiencies and inflammatory indicators.
- Personalized Protocol Design ∞ Based on the diagnostic data, a tailored protocol addresses specific deficiencies and imbalances. This might involve precise dosages of bioidentical hormones or specific peptide combinations. The formulation targets optimal ranges, moving beyond “normal” to what supports peak performance and vitality.
- Strategic Administration ∞ Hormones and peptides are administered through various methods, including subcutaneous injections, topical creams, or oral compounds, selected for optimal absorption and efficacy. Precise timing and consistency become paramount for sustained results.
- Continuous Performance Monitoring ∞ Regular follow-up appointments and repeat blood tests are crucial. This ongoing data collection allows for fine-tuning the protocol, ensuring it aligns with the body’s dynamic responses and the individual’s evolving goals. Adjustments ensure sustained progress and mitigate potential deviations.
- Integrated Lifestyle Optimization ∞ While direct interventions are powerful, their efficacy is amplified by supporting lifestyle elements. This includes structured exercise regimens, nutrient-dense dietary plans, stress modulation techniques, and strategic sleep hygiene. The timeline for observing benefits varies with the specific protocol and individual physiology. With hormone optimization Meaning ∞ Hormone optimization refers to the clinical process of assessing and adjusting an individual’s endocrine system to achieve physiological hormone levels that support optimal health, well-being, and cellular function. protocols, initial shifts in energy and mood can become noticeable within a few weeks. A more profound impact on physical attributes, such as body composition and muscle strength, typically requires several months of consistent adherence.
Testosterone Replacement Therapy, for example, often yields improvements in libido and vitality within the first month, followed by enhanced muscle protein synthesis and fat metabolism over three to six months. Sustained improvements accrue over longer periods, as the body adapts to its new, optimized equilibrium.
Peptide therapies also present distinct timelines for their effects. Peptides that stimulate growth hormone release, for instance, can enhance sleep quality and recovery within weeks, while their full effects on body composition Meaning ∞ Body composition refers to the proportional distribution of the primary constituents that make up the human body, specifically distinguishing between fat mass and fat-free mass, which includes muscle, bone, and water. and tissue repair become evident over several months. Other peptides, targeting specific areas like injury recovery or cognitive enhancement, might demonstrate more rapid, localized effects.
